This is an early draft, not yet complete, but perhaps it > will be useful for suggesting what we might do as a reach-out effort to > those unfamiliar with our current work, standards, and tools. > > --Jeff > > -- Jeff Waters > > The document named Draft ValueListURN_Tutorial (ValueListURN_Tutorial.ppt) > has been submitted by Jeff Waters to the EM Reference Information Model SC > document repository. > > Document Description: > This set of slides is designed to serve as an educational tutorial on how > the ValueListURN allows users to interact with their externally-managed > policies to route emergency information using the Distribution Element > (DE). The ValueListURN provides a simple structure to specify the name of > the policy and to specify a set of terms from that policy. The tutorial > illustrates what the policy statements look like when expressed as > "triples", the recommended format utilized by the W3C standards, > Resource Description Framework (RDF) and the Web Ontology Language (OWL). > The tutorial concludes by illustrating how useful routing information can > be extracted from the policy statement using the standard query language, > SPARQL. > > View Document Details: > http://www.oasis-open.org/committees/document.php?document_id=35974 > > Download Document: > http://www.oasis-open.org/committees/download.php/35974/ValueListURN_Tutorial.ppt > > > PLEASE NOTE: If the above links do not work for you, your email application > may be breaking the link into two pieces.
